    Getting to Sarteneja is long and tedious just because the roads are so bad! But the village itself is beautiful and the people are nice and friendly. We enjoyed breakfast and Raquel's kitchen. We went out round 8:30 Saturday night looking for food but almost everything was closed, except the bars and they didn't have food. Make sure to have cash handy and if you're driving yourself, make sure your tank is filled before getting on the road.
